Brenwood Park Assisted Living is a residential care community located in Franklin, Wisconsin, providing assisted living services for seniors who require support with activities of daily living. The facility is structured to deliver individualized care plans tailored to each resident’s needs, supporting independence while offering assistance with tasks such as bathing, dressing, toileting (all with full assistance), and eating (with some physical assistance). Brenwood Park emphasizes a homelike environment, offering support with medication management, meals, housekeeping, and access to a variety of social and recreational activities.
The facility provides a broad range of care and medical support services. Onsite nursing staff coordinate with physicians and healthcare specialists to address resident needs, including diabetes care, incontinence care, ambulatory care, and hospice services. Occupational and speech therapy are available, supported by English-speaking staff, to meet diverse rehabilitation requirements. Mental wellness programming is offered, and a memory care option serves residents with memory-related conditions. Fitness programs are provided to encourage physical well-being, and podiatry care is accessible for those with foot health needs.
For personal grooming and social engagement, Brenwood Park offers a barber shop and beauty salon. Residents can participate in clubs and community groups designed to foster meaningful connections. The facility manages medication for residents and supports specialized care needs such as hospice and memory care through individualized plans.
Resident and family experiences with Brenwood Park Assisted Living vary widely. Positive feedback often centers on compassionate, professional staff and attentive leadership, with families noting effective communication, thorough care, and an engaging environment adapted to resident needs. Satisfied residents and families report feeling secure and valued, with active efforts to resolve concerns.
Conversely, some reviews raise issues with severe understaffing, lapses in training, high employee turnover, and unmet care plans. Concerns include missed medications and meals, unaddressed call lights, delayed hygiene assistance, and observed unprofessional behavior among staff. Periods of unreliable care and fluctuating food quality are also mentioned, suggesting variability in service depending on staffing circumstances.
Prospective residents and families should carefully assess current staffing levels and service quality during their decision-making process, as experiences have been noted to differ over time and among residents. Costs at this community start at $5,000 and range up to $5,500. The average price in the community is $5,403, which is less than the average price in the area of $5,713. The cost of assisted living in this area is essentially the same as the cost throughout the state. If the resident needs other services, additional services may increase the monthly cost.
